Identification of the Genetic Sources of Variability of the Adaptation of the Ventricular Repolarisation at a Pharmacological and Physiological Stimulus in an Apparently Normal Population

研究概览
简要总结
The main objective is to research for genetic factors involved in the extreme modifications of the QT interval of the electrocardiogram in answer to a pharmacological stimulation (sotalol) and physiological stimulation in the apparently normal general population.
The phenotypic characterization, based on the ventricular repolarisation dynamics will be used aiming at term of the predictive genetic factors of the acquired long QT syndrome
详细描述
Study of 1000 apparently healthy subjects which will receive an unique dose of Sotalol and will have an effort test on ergonomic bicycle, an auditive stimulation and a taking of DNA.

入选标准
- •Both sexes
- •Age between 18 and 60 years
- •European or North African Origin
- •Body mass index between 19 and 29 kg / m ²
- •Obtaining informed and written consent
排除标准
- •Heart rate < 50 bpm
- •Systolic blood pressure < 100 mm Hg
- •Atrioventricular block
- •Known chronic illness with chronic treatment
- •Raynaud phenomenon
- •QT prolonging drug
- •Family or personal history of the congenital long QT syndrome
- •QT/QTc Fridericia (QTcf) > 450 ms
- •Pregnancy
